M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.
Find out more about this engaging new book MOOCs and Open Education
M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
that
examines
subjects
regarding open
education resources
(OERs) and
massively open online courses.
Recent
advancements in
distance learning technology enable
people
all over the world
to participate in courses via the Internet.
These massively open online courses are
commonly free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
